Using Cable Interface Debug Commands
Debug Cable Modem Ranging Messages
This command activates debugging of ranging messages from cablemodems on the HFC network.
When this command is activated, ranging messages generated when cablemodems request or change
their upstream frequencies are displayed on the Cisco uBR7200 series console. The format for the
command follows:
CMTS01# debug cable range
To deactivate debugging of cablemodem ranging, use the following command:
CMTS01# no debug cable range
Debug Upstream Messages
Thiscommand activates debugging of upstream messages from cable modems. When this command is
activated, any messages generated by cablemodems and sent to the Cisco uBR7200 series will be
displayed on the Cisco uBR7200 series console. The format for the command follows:
CMTS01# debug cable receive
To deactivate debugging of upstream messages, use the followingcommand:
CMTS01# no debug cable receive
Debug Cable Modem Registration Requests
This command activates debugging of registration requests from cablemodems on the HFC network.
When this command is activated, messages generated by cablemodems as they make requests to
connect to the network are displayed on the Cisco uBR7200 series console. The format for the
command follows:
CMTS01# debug cable reg
To deactivate debugging of cable registration, use the following command:
CMTS01# no debug cable reg
Debug Cable Modem Reset Messages
This command activatesdebugging of reset messages from cable modems on the HFC network. When
this command is activated, reset messages generated by cablemodems are displayed on the
Cisco uBR7200 series console. The format for the command follows:
CMTS01# debug cable reset
To deactivate debugging of cable reset messages, use the following command:
CMTS01# no debug cable reset
